Jiva Organics Barnyard Millet is a 2-pound bag of premium, USDA-certified organic whole grain millet. Naturally gluten-free and non-GMO, it offers a rich source of protein and fiber, making it an ideal superfood for healthy cooking. Versatile and easy to prepare, it supports a clean, sustainable diet and is perfect for a variety of traditional and modern recipes.
